Ticket: Config drift in Pixelcrush CLI batch resizer

The staging and prod installs of Pixelcrush have diverged again: staging clamps output width at 2048 while prod still allows 4096, and the JPEG quality defaults differ. Future maintainers should treat the committed config as the single source of truth and reconcile hosts against it. For reference, the canonical values are listed below.

config for bafof-tajef:
[silion]
port = 5000
team = silmir
host = silion.crelvonet.internal
region = lower-3
access_code = ac_1f1b57
timeout_ms = 2000

### Key Ceremony Checklist — Item 7: InvoicePress Signing Key

Owner: release manager. Confirm the PDF invoice renderer (InvoicePress v4) builds from the tagged commit. Verify rendered sample invoices match golden files byte-for-byte. Generate the new document-signing keypair on the air-gapped laptop. Two witnesses initial the ledger. Export public key only; private key stays on the HSM card. Seal the backup card in envelope B. Recovery material: the envelope's contents can only be activated with the passphrase recorded directly below.

unlock words, hahip-baduf: holwyn-istath-julvan

Welcome to the TileHoist team. TileHoist prefetches map tiles for the Wayfarer Atlas client, predicting pan direction from the last three viewport moves and warming the cache two zoom levels deep. Config lives in prefetch.yaml; tune the lookahead budget before touching eviction logic. If the encrypted settings vault is ever locked after a failed rotation, you will need the recovery passphrase, which is recorded directly below.

strongbox words: zorwyn-sorael-belion-ulaius-silmir-ulays-briax-rusdor-gorix

Subject: GiftNote mailer cut-over complete

Team,

The donation-receipt mailer (GiftNote) moved to the new Larkspur cluster last night. Old queue drained at 02:10, DNS flipped at 02:30, and the first receipts went out from the new stack by 02:45. No bounced sends so far. Template rendering is unchanged; only the transport layer moved. For review, the new production instance was brought up with the configuration below.

deployment values, fafog-fawip:
[jorox]
team = fendor
access_code = ac_bb00ea
host = jorox.qorveltech.internal
port = 9200
owner = istdor.aldeth
peer = julvan.orvexlabs.internal